Written Answers. - Speech Therapist Appointment.

Colm M. Hilliard

Question:

146 Mr. Hilliard asked the Minister for Health when will he appoint a full-time speech therapist to St. Mary's Special School, Athlumney, Navan, County Meath, as this service is urgently required by the school;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

Despite their best efforts the North-Eastern Health Board have not been able to recruit speech therapists. The board are contributing to the training costs of two speech therapists who have contracted to work for the board for a minimum of one year. They will be available later in the summer.
